Michigan fans have gotten spoiled over the last few years of the amazing recruiting that headman, Brady Hoke has created. Michigan has 21 commits in their 2013 class already before the season even started. That is unheard of and it looks like they will only have 3 or 4 more spots left in this class. Well, Michigan is having their annual summer football camp and usually they offer a good handful of kids there. This year with so limited spots many thought that they wouldn't offer anyone for the 2013 class. That wasn't the case when NC CB Channing Stribling was offered with being a little to no name. Reports have stated that he has had an excellent showing during camp and it eventually lead to an offer. Now it seems like there is an possibility that he could end up becoming an Wolverine. Many would prefer waiting for a bigger name like MD CB Kendall Fuller or FL CB Leon McQuay, but the coaches know better than anyone who they can get, who fits best in their system, and who is the right fit for their team. Stribling is unrated on Rivals and is only a 2 star on Scout, so does that mean he is not a good player or does that mean he is not likely that he will become an All-American in college? Well, based on these results from prospects that were rated low, that is not the case at all.

Here is a list of 3 or lower star players that had great careers in college or is having great careers in college now. Base on Rivals ratings.
Aldon Smith (Missouri)- 3 star
Brandon Pettigrew (Oklahoma State)- 2 star
Pat White (West Virginia)- 3 star
Russel Okung (Oklahoma State)- 3 star
Malcom Jenkins (Ohio State)- 3 star
Brian Robiskie (Ohio State)- 3 star
Jason Smith (Baylor)- 2 Star
Dan Lefevour (Central Michigan)- 2 star
Chris Johnson (East Carolina)- 2 star
Michael Johnson (Georgia Tech)- 3 star
Tyson Jackson (Louisiana State)- 3 star
Ciron Black (Louisiana State) - 3 star
Mike Hart (Michigan)- 3 star
Chase Daniel (Missouri)- 3 star
Evander Hood (Missouri)- 3 star
Juaquin Iglesias (Oklahoma)-3 star
Sam Bradford (Oklahoma)- 3 star
Trent Williams (Oklahoma)- 3 star
Greg Hardy (Ole Miss)- 3 star
Max Unger (Oregon)- 3 star
Jeremiah Masoli (Oregon)- Unranked
Darryl Clark (Penn State)- 3 star
Paul Posluszny (Penn State)- 3 star
Ray Rice (Rutgers)- 3 star
Jerry Hughes (TCU)-2 star
Colt McCoy (Texas)- 3 star
George Selvie (USF)- 2 star
Steve Slaton (WVU)- 3 star
PJ Hill (Wisconsin)- 2 star
DeAndre Levy (Wisconsin)- 3 star
Javier Arenas (Alabama)- 3 star
Jacob Hester (LSU)- 2 star
Greg McElroy (Alabama)- 3 star
Matt Ryan (Boston College)- 3 star
Patrick Willis (Ole Miss)- 3 star
Greg Jones (Michigan State)- 3 star
James Rodgers (Oregon State)- 2 star
Morris Claiborne (LSU)- 3 star
Justin Blackmon (Oklahoma State)- 3 star
Ryan Tannehill (Texas A&M)- 3 star
Kendall Wright (Baylor)- 3 star
Brandon Weeden (Oklahoma State)- not rated
Coby Fleener (Stanford)- 3 star
Nick Fairley (Auburn)- 3 star
Ryan Kerrigan (Purdue)- 3 star
J.J. Watt (Wisconsin)- 2 star
Andy Dalton (TCU)- 3 star
Bacarri Rambo (Georgia)- 3 star
Keith Price (Washington)- 3 star
Collin Klein (Kansas State)- 3 star
Kawann Short (Purdue)- 3 star
Ryan Swope (Texas A&M)- 3 star
Kenjon Barner (Oregon)- 3 star
Micah Hyde (Iowa)- 2 star
